Guangdong court facilitates mediation in copyright and unfair competition dispute concerning Pokémon
2025-04-27
In a landmark case for intellectual property rights in China's gaming sector, the Guangdong High People’s Court of successfully mediated in a copyright and unfair competition dispute between Japan’s Pokémon Company and four Chinese gaming companies in February 2025.
